Output 762a59888e1434fc6a4f77d3ac049c4e1b035c540224cad015ba03a9d1649a06:2

value
3521858
script pubkey
OP_0 OP_PUSHBYTES_20 25af53129f34d05984beba02de2f2ed2c2d656c0
address
ltc1qykh4xy5lxng9np97hgpdutew6tpdv4kqd4u5r6
transaction
762a59888e1434fc6a4f77d3ac049c4e1b035c540224cad015ba03a9d1649a06
spent
true